I’ve already made it clear that I love this letter by the US Catholic Bishops. As I begin to write about this, a couple of notes. First, all page numbers refer to the internet version linked here.
Second, don’t let anyone tell you this document is about same sex unions. The internet version is 60 printed pages. Of these, less than 3 full pages deal directly with same sex unions. That is, less than 5% of the document deals with same sex unions. That is about the correct proportion.

is the name of the Catholic Bishops’ Pastoral Letter on Marriage. I will be writing about this in upcoming days. This document is really great and is not getting the attention it deserves. It is being upstage by the Manhattan Declaration, which is also good and worthwhile. Oddly enough, the Pastoral letter of the Catholic Bishops is actually more ecumenical than the Manhattan Declaration because the Declaration is specifically and emphatically Christian. Now, of course, the Bishops’ letter is too, not only Christian, but Catholic Christian. But I think that a Jewish person would have an easier time embracing the Bishops’ letter than the Manhattan Declaration. Maybe not. Jewish readers, what say you?
